The Latest State to Ban the Crates: New Jersey! [[link removed]]
On factory farms, gestation crates trap female pigs used for breeding in tiny metal cages barely larger than their bodies. These crates are cruel and cause immense physical and psychological harm—and New Jersey has joined the list of states that agree!
New Jersey Governor Phil Murphy signed a new bill into law banning the use of crates for mother pigs and also baby cows exploited for veal. New Jersey is the ninth state to get on board for a better future for farmed animals.

We Hosted Our First-Ever Fishes Webinar [[link removed]]
On August 22, in conjunction with advocates from the Animal Legal Defense Fund and Friends of Philip Fish Sanctuary, we hosted “Expanding Our Circle of Compassion: Fishes in the Pet Industry,” an informative webinar that shed light on the suffering that fishes sold as pets endure. Don’t Let Travel Derail Your Plant-Based Goals [[link removed]]
Summer isn’t over yet! As you’re planning any last-minute getaways, remember that eating plant-based doesn’t have to be left at home.
Before your trip, research plant-based options at your travel destination and tuck a few restaurants in your back pocket for when you arrive. Dive into the local cuisine, which likely features many plant-based traditional dishes already. Online groups and reviews can be super helpful, too, when looking into meal options.
